Classmates sought for St. Peter’s reunion
The class of 1961 of St. Peter’s Grammar School, Belleville, is planning a 50th reunion. Classmates should email Barbara @[email protected] or Marie@[email protected] for more information.

OLV commemorative cookbooks available
The Our Lady of Victories (OLV) Senior Group is offering the OLV 125th Anniversary Commemorative Cookbook, a compilation of recipes from parishioners. Sale price is two for $10. To purchase, visit the church pastoral center or call Teri at 732-727-7639.
